2.cordon vt.封锁;用警戒线围住
例句:The roads were cordoned off.
这些道路被封锁了。
Police cordoned off the area until the bomb was defused.
警方封锁了这个地区直到炸弹被拆除为止。
3.intervene vi.出面; 介入
例句:The President intervened personally in the crisis.
总统亲自出面处理这场危机。
She might have been killed if the neighbours hadn't intervened.
要不是邻居介入,她可能会没命了。
4.accountable adj.负有责任的, 应对自己的行为做出说明的,(对自己的决定、行为)负有责任,有说明义务
例句:I am accountable to my superiors for my actions.
我应该为自己的行为对上司负责。
5.evacuate vt.vi.撤离, 疏散
例句:They all evacuated when the enemy approached the city.
敌人逼近这个城市时他们已撤退了。
6.whereby adv.靠那个; 凭那个; 借以
例句:Whereby shall we know her?
我们靠什么认出她呢?
7.appreciate v.(充分)意识到,觉察,察知,注意到;懂得,体会,领会,理解
例句:I really appreciate the danger of this job.
我真的认识到了这份工作的危险。
8.scrap vt.废弃,丢弃; 取消; 抛弃; 报废
例句:In the end, the decision to scrap the project was unanimous.
最后,大家一致决定放弃这一项目。
